“Ambition”

His ambition 
fascinated her—a reflection 
of her own drive  

for ultimate   
control in answering only to   
her own wishes. 

He drew her in 
with his passionate promises 
whispered in bed 
  
while her husband 
and children slept in innocence 
and ignorance. 


On moon filled nights 
she pledged her bright future to him, 
desperately 

clinging to him. 
Crumbling her disillusionment 
within her fist. 

Wagering all 
against a bid for happiness 
with a new life 

centered on him. 
She counted on his commitment 
to her—for them, 

to bind old wounds 
and invent a life together 
without heartache. 

Year drifts to year 
as her love grows, but his wavers 
and then retreats 

back to control 
of his own life and ambitions. 
He abandons 

her for himself. 
His selfishness now a mirror 
for her sorrow.
